Jeanne L. Love, age 85, 1322 Love Station Road, Erwin, went home to be with the Lord at 12:58 p.m. Thursday, February 14, 2013, at Unicoi County Memorial Hospital.

She was born and reared in Unicoi County, a daughter of the late James and Leatha Rose Osborne Lewis. Mrs. Love was a loving housewife and worked in the florist and retail clothing business. She was a long time faithful member of Love Chapel Christian Church where she was actively involved and served as treasurer for her Sunday School Class. She and Clarence were always very active and was in charge of refreshments at Bible School. Jeanne was also known as the "Pecan Lady" because she sold pecans to raise money for church projects. When her children were young she was actively involved with and was a past president of the PTA at Love Chapel School. Mrs. Love and her husband Clarence were members of the Unicoi County Sports Hall of Fame. They were avid Unicoi county sports fans and worked as band boosters for many years. Mrs. Love was a member of Eastern Star Lodge # 276.
